Description
OverviewSpecific Responsibilities - include but are not limited to :
- Maintain a welcoming and positive attitude to promote quality golf experience to members and their guests and to enrich the work environment for others.
- Conduct oneself in a professional manner and always maintain a professional image.
- Assist in the promotion, planning, organization, and execution of the highest quality golf events for members, guests, and outside entities.
- Teach and promote the game of golf to all members.
Experience Required
Must have worked in golf for at least 5 years with a minium of 3 years as a manager.
Essential Responsibilities
Operations
- Assist with golfer check-in and fee collection, control and manage daily play and the tee sheet data capture and optimize.
- Assist with all opening and closing procedures.
- Train, supervise and schedule Golf Operations Outside Staff with the goal of ensuring the highest quality customer experience.
- Assist in managing golf car operation, practice facility, and club storage service.
- Assist in planning and budgeting for the golf operation.
- Assist in tournament operations and weekly events including planning, pre-tournament contracts, post- tournament billing, promotion, course set-up, preparation, scoring, prize distribution, and follow up.
- Assist in coordinating golf activities with other departments.
- Effectively manage the pace of play on the golf course to ensure satisfaction with all players.
- Provide club repair and club fitting services to customers.
- Directly responsible for timely and consistently maintaining the club's USGA Handicap System.
Instruction
- Create and implement player development programs for all skill levels to include junior, ladies, beginners, and advanced players.
- Play golf with a variety of customers in competitive and non-competitive situations.
- Give lessons to members.
- Club fitting sessions.
Golf Shop Retail
- Oversee and execute the daily operations of the Golf Shop.
- Assist in the inventory control of hard goods, soft goods, and special orders including ordering procedures, receiving procedures, inputting into point of sale, pricing procedures, display, and sales.
- Ensure the Golf Shop is clean, orderly, well-stocked and professionally always presented.
- Monitor and regularly update sales display areas and merchandise high traffic areas.
Miscellaneous
- One Assistant Professional is expected to always be on site, unless permitted by the Head Professional.
- Responsibility for the daily golf operation takes precedence over giving lessons to members and guests.
